Overview Cidfree 20mg Injection
Acidaze 20mg Injection reduces stomach acid production, treating acid-related gastrointestinal disorders like reflux, indigestion, peptic ulcers, and other conditions stemming from excessive acid. Its rapid action offers swift relief from acidity. Used prophylactically against stress ulcers in critically ill patients, it's also administered pre-anesthesia to mitigate aspiration risks. Classified as a proton pump inhibitor (PPI), it's intravenously administered by a healthcare professional only when deemed superior to oral forms. Dosage and treatment duration are determined by your physician based on your condition and response. Optimal results are achieved by consuming smaller, more frequent meals and avoiding caffeine, spicy, and fatty foods. Common, usually mild, side effects include nausea, vomiting, headache, dizziness, gas, diarrhea, abdominal pain, and thrombophlebitis (vein inflammation). Persistent or bothersome symptoms necessitate medical consultation. Prolonged use, particularly exceeding one year, may increase bone fracture risk, especially at higher doses. Discuss bone loss prevention strategies, such as calcium and vitamin D supplementation, with your doctor. Hypomagnesemia (low magnesium) has been reported after three months or more of use, potentially causing fatigue, confusion, dizziness, muscle spasms, and arrhythmias. Your doctor might monitor your magnesium levels. Acidaze 20mg Injection is contraindicated for those with severe liver disease, those on HIV medication, those with a history of PPI allergy, or existing osteoporosis. Pregnant or breastfeeding individuals should consult their physician. Alcohol should be avoided due to its acid-stimulating effect. Refrain from operating machinery if dizziness or drowsiness occurs.

How Cidfree 20mg Injection works:
Acifree 20mg Injection, a proton pump inhibitor, lessens stomach acid production, providing relief from acid indigestion and heartburn symptoms.
SAFETY ADVICE
AlcoholCAUTION
Use caution when drinking alcohol while using Cidfree 20mg Injection. Seek medical advice.
PregnancyC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R
The use of Cidfree 20mg Injection during pregnancy may pose risks. While human data is scarce, animal research indicates potential harm to the fetus. A physician will assess the potential advantages against possible risks prior to prescribing. Seek medical advice.
Breast feedingC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R
The use of Cidfree 20mg Injection while breastfeeding is likely inadvisable. Available human data indicates potential transfer of the medication into breast milk, posing a possible risk to the infant.
DrivingC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R
The effect of Cidfree 20mg Injection on driving ability is unknown. Refrain from driving if you experience symptoms impairing concentration or reaction time.
KidneySAFE IF PRESCRIBED
Individuals with kidney impairment may safely administer Cidfree 20mg Injection without requiring a modified dosage.
LiverCAUTION
The administration of Cidfree 20mg Injection requires careful consideration in individuals suffering from advanced liver impairment. A modified dosage of Cidfree 20mg Injection might be necessary. Physician consultation is advised.
